From 26be5bf7572ddea2781ed97141de74a6a6a90dd0 Mon Sep 17 00:00:00 2001 From: Flummi Date: Mon, 19 Feb 2018 18:28:06 +0100 Subject: [PATCH] statistics lol --- src/routes/r/about.mjs | 11 ++++++++++- 1 file changed, 10 insertions(+), 1 deletion(-) diff --git a/src/routes/r/about.mjs b/src/routes/r/about.mjs index be0b900..3d9ef3a 100644 --- a/src/routes/r/about.mjs +++ b/src/routes/r/about.mjs @@ -1,5 +1,11 @@ import express from "express"; +import db from "../../lib/sql"; + +const queries = { + statistic: "select count(*) as sum from `pastes`" +}; + export default express.Router() .get("/", (req, res) => { res.render("about"); @@ -11,5 +17,8 @@ export default express.Router() res.render("contact"); }) .get("/statistics", (req, res) => { - res.render("statistics"); + db.exec(queries.statistic).then(rows => { + const r = rows[0]; + res.render("statistics", { pastes: r.sum }); + }).catch(err => console.log(err)); }); \ No newline at end of file